Instructor: Dalya F. Massachi
is a widely published writer, consultant and progressive activist
who appreciates the importance and complexity of social change
work. For over 13 years, her work with community organizations
has focused on fund development and communications. She has written
scores of successful grant proposals and marketing pieces; has
authored a number of news articles and columns; and has contributed
to three books on progressive social change. She has also co-produced
several websites and radio productions. Since 2001 Dalya has taught
writing techniques to several hundred workshop participants. She
will soon publish "Writing to Make a Difference: 50
Ways toAdvance Your Mission & Boost Your Impact."
From 2000-2004, Dalya served as Founding Director of the network of international development NGOs in the San Francisco Bay Area (BAIDO) -- and now sits on that Board. She has worked or studied in Central America, Africa, Israel, the U.K., and several regions of the U.S. In addition, she has extensive experience in the global womens movement. Dalya holds an M.A. in Communication & International Development and a B.A. in International Studies. Read her full resume.
